Skip to content Gå til innhold


How to kill a program or process in OS X Hvordan drepe et program eller prosess i OS X

Mac

The following tutorial will show you how to kill programs/processes in OS X. Følgende veiledningen vil vise deg hvordan å drepe programmer / prosesser i OS X.

Use the following information very carefully. Bruk følgende informasjon nøye. Killing processes in OS X can cause system instability and full scale OS crashes. Killing prosessene i OS X kan føre til et ustabilt system og fullskala OS krasjer. With that said, this tutorial will show you how to 'quit' a program or process when it's not listed in the dock, “Force Quit” menu etc. Med det sagt, denne opplæringen vil vise deg hvordan du "Avslutt" et program eller prosess når det ikke er oppført i dokken, "Force Quit"-menyen osv.

  1. Typically when you're looking to force something to quit, it's because the program or process is eating up a ton of CPU. Vanligvis når du er ute etter å tvinge noe å slutte, er det fordi programmet eller prosessen er å spise opp massevis av CPU. To identify the program/process, open an OS X terminal by going into your Applications -> Utilities and selecting Terminal . Å identifisere programmet / prosessen, åpner du et OS X-terminal ved å gå inn i Applications -> Utilities og velge Terminal. Once a terminal has opened, you can get a list of the running programs by entering the command top . Når en terminal er åpnet, kan du få en liste over aktive programmer ved å skrive kommandoen toppen.
  2. den øverste kommandoen i en terminal osx
    click to enlarge Klikk for å forstørre

  3. To quit the top program simply hit the q key on your keyboard. Å avslutte toppen programmet bare trykke på q tasten på tastaturet. As seen above, the default “sorting” for the top command is by PID (Process ID). Som sett ovenfor, er standard "sortering" for den øverste kommandoen av PID (Process ID). Since this doesn't always help identify which program is hogging your CPU, run top with the following string: top -o cpu Siden dette ikke hjelper alltid å identifisere hvilket program er hogging på CPU, kjører topp med følgende streng: top-o cpu

    That will launch top and sort the processes by which ones are using the most CPU. Det vil lansere topp og sortere prosesser som de bruker mest CPU. In the example below you'll see that top itself is actually using the most CPU. I eksempelet nedenfor vil du se at toppen i seg selv er faktisk bruker mest CPU.

  4. den øverste kommandoen i en terminal osx sortert etter cpu
    click to enlarge Klikk for å forstørre

  5. Again, hit the letter q to quit top . Igjen slo bokstaven q for å avslutte toppen. If you've identified the program you want to end, make note of it's PID . Hvis du har funnet programmet du ønsker å avslutte, noterer det er PID. In the screenshot below I'm using MozyBackup as my example, and it has a PID of 1488 I skjermbildet nedenfor Jeg bruker MozyBackup som mitt eksempel, og den har en PID av 1488
  6. den øverste kommandoen i en terminal osx sortert etter cpu
    click to enlarge Klikk for å forstørre

  7. To quit MozyBackup, enter the command kill -9 1488 . Hvis du vil avslutte MozyBackup, skriv inn kommandoen kill -9 1488. Broken down, that's kill (the command to 'kill' a program) -9 (the “non-catchable, non-ignorable kill” – basically it means kill this program no matter what) and 1488 (the PID that you want killed). Brytes ned, som dreper (kommandoen for å "drepe" et program) -9 (de "ikke-catchable, ikke-ignorable drepe" - utgangspunktet betyr det å drepe dette programmet uansett hva) og 1488 (IDen du vil drepte) .
  8. drepe prosesser i osx terminal
    click to enlarge Klikk for å forstørre

  9. As you'll see in the above screenshot, I was unable to kill the PID 1488. Som du ser i over skjermene, var jeg ikke i stand til å drepe PID 1488. That's because the program in question wasn't owned (being run) by me – rather, it was being run by the root user. Det er fordi det aktuelle programmet ikke var eid (kjøres) av meg - i stedet var det kjøres av root brukeren. To get around this, and use this command with care , enter sudo kill -9 1488 . For å løse dette, og bruke denne kommandoen med omhu, skriver sudo kill -9 1488. You'll be asked for your password, and after entering it, the process 1488 will be killed. Du vil bli spurt om passord, og når du har åpnet den, vil prosessen 1488 bli drept.
  10. drepe prosesser i os x terminal
    click to enlarge Klikk for å forstørre

  11. For detailed information on the top and kill programs, enter man top or man kill from the terminal to view the manual pages for each program. For detaljert informasjon på toppen og drepe programmer, skriver man øverst eller mann drepe fra terminalen for å vise den manuelle sider for hvert program.

Posted in Posted in Mac Mac . .

Get Simple Help tutorials just like this one in your email inbox every day - for free! Få Enkelt Hjelp opplæring akkurat som dette i innboksen hver dag - helt gratis! Just enter your email address below: Bare skriv inn din e-postadresse nedenfor:

You can always opt out of this email subscription at any time. Du kan alltid velge bort denne e-abonnementet når som helst.

4 Responses 4 Svar

Stay in touch with the conversation, subscribe to the Hold kontakten med samtalen, abonnere på RSS feed for comments on this post RSS feed for kommentarer til dette innlegget . .

  1. Jaime King says Jaime King sier

    Thank you so much I spent a LONG time trying to figure out why my macbook was running so slow and the fan was on full blast. Takk så mye jeg brukte lang tid prøver å finne ut hvorfor min macbook var løper så tregt og viften var på full blast. I wish I had seen this site before i talked to that clueless tool on Apple's tech support line Jeg skulle ønske jeg hadde sett dette området før jeg snakket med at clueless verktøyet på Apples tech support linje

  2. Tommy Jackson Tommy Jackson says sier

    Thanks for this. Takk for denne. Peerguardian was driving me insane, but all sorted now PeerGuardian drev meg gal, men alle sorteres nå :-)

  3. MattD says MattD sier

    Just Spotlight “Activity Monitor” and kill the process. Bare Spotlight "Activity Monitor og drepe prosessen.

Continuing the Discussion Fortsetter Discussion

  1. Kill command on OS X at Rage on Omnipotent Kill kommandoen på OS X på Rage den Allmektige linked to this post on October 17, 2007 knyttet til dette innlegget den 17 oktober 2007

    [...] command on OS X Published by Tom on 17/10/2007 in IT. [...] Kommandoen på OS X Publisert av Tom 17/10/2007 innen IT. . . Useful summary of killing processes on OS [...] Nyttig oversikt over drepe prosesser på OS [...]



Some HTML is OK Some HTML is OK

or, reply to this post via eller svare på dette innlegget via trackback styrekule . .